« Reply #55 on: Sep 23, 2015, 01:37 PM »
Could we get a couple pictures of those gauntlets please?

As you wish







They're pretty simple, just some Sintra trapezoids shaped around my arms attached with velcro (although with shaping that's mostly unnecessary). Intentionally different lengths as the one on my right hand has wrapping above it. Eventually, I'd like to add spikes to the left gauntlet (not sure what the best way to do that is though) and my clan logo to the right (after I become official).

Yes the CRLs say that you can have bare gauntlets, however since they are un-painted and un-weathered at this time they look like you just rolled some sintra and called it a day.  Also, talk to your Alor'ad, you should be able to get permission to put the clan sigil on your armor prior to approval.  I was able to, and all my UMs have to do to put the Kyrimorut Crab on their armor is ask (we've even got templates already made).  I'd suggest at least putting some weathering on the gauntlets and perhaps putting a few 'buttons' and things on there so they don't look quite so clean and new.  That being said, it's your kit and you can do what you want with it.
